Lais Andrade eaaf5331d6 Introduce alarm and media vibration intensity settings
Introduce toggles and sliders to configure the alarm and media
vibrations in the "Vibration & haptics" settings app.

Also update the multiple intensities configuration flag into a integer,
where the device can specify how many distinct levels are supported.
Follow existing implementation to map the intensities to higher setting
values.

Bug: 198346559
Bug: 207477604
Test: [Alarm|Media]Vibration[Intensity|Toggle]PreferenceControllerTest

package com.android.settings.accessibility;
import static com.google.common.truth.Truth.assertThat;
import static org.mockito.Mockito.when;
import android.content.Context;
import android.os.VibrationAttributes;
import android.os.Vibrator;
import android.provider.Settings;
import androidx.preference.PreferenceScreen;
import androidx.preference.SwitchPreference;
import androidx.test.core.app.ApplicationProvider;
import com.android.settings.core.BasePreferenceController;
import com.android.settingslib.core.lifecycle.Lifecycle;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.mockito.Mock;
import org.mockito.MockitoAnnotations;
import org.robolectric.RobolectricTestRunner;
@RunWith(RobolectricTestRunner.class)
public class AlarmVibrationTogglePreferenceControllerTest {
private static final String PREFERENCE_KEY = "preference_key";
@Mock private PreferenceScreen mScreen;
private Lifecycle mLifecycle;
private Context mContext;
private Vibrator mVibrator;
private AlarmVibrationTogglePreferenceController mController;
private SwitchPreference mPreference;
@Before
public void setUp() {
MockitoAnnotations.initMocks(this);
mLifecycle = new Lifecycle(() -> mLifecycle);
mContext = ApplicationProvider.getApplicationContext();
mVibrator = mContext.getSystemService(Vibrator.class);
mController = new AlarmVibrationTogglePreferenceController(mContext, PREFERENCE_KEY);
mLifecycle.addObserver(mController);
mPreference = new SwitchPreference(mContext);
mPreference.setSummary("Test summary");
when(mScreen.findPreference(mController.getPreferenceKey())).thenReturn(mPreference);
mController.displayPreference(mScreen);
}
@Test
public void verifyConstants() {
assertThat(mController.getPreferenceKey()).isEqualTo(PREFERENCE_KEY);
assertThat(mController.getAvailabilityStatus())
.isEqualTo(BasePreferenceController.AVAILABLE);
}
@Test
public void missingSetting_shouldReturnDefault() {
Settings.System.putString(mContext.getContentResolver(),
Settings.System.ALARM_VIBRATION_INTENSITY, /* value= */ null);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isTrue();
}
@Test
public void updateState_shouldDisplayOnOffState() {
updateSetting(Settings.System.ALARM_VIBRATION_INTENSITY, Vibrator.VIBRATION_INTENSITY_HIGH);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isTrue();
updateSetting(Settings.System.ALARM_VIBRATION_INTENSITY,
Vibrator.VIBRATION_INTENSITY_MEDIUM);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isTrue();
updateSetting(Settings.System.ALARM_VIBRATION_INTENSITY, Vibrator.VIBRATION_INTENSITY_LOW);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isTrue();
updateSetting(Settings.System.ALARM_VIBRATION_INTENSITY, Vibrator.VIBRATION_INTENSITY_OFF);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isFalse();
}
@Test
public void setChecked_updatesIntensityAndDependentSettings() throws Exception {
updateSetting(Settings.System.ALARM_VIBRATION_INTENSITY, Vibrator.VIBRATION_INTENSITY_OFF);
mController.updateState(mPreference);
assertThat(mPreference.isChecked()).isFalse();
mController.setChecked(true);
assertThat(readSetting(Settings.System.ALARM_VIBRATION_INTENSITY)).isEqualTo(
mVibrator.getDefaultVibrationIntensity(VibrationAttributes.USAGE_ALARM));
mController.setChecked(false);
assertThat(readSetting(Settings.System.ALARM_VIBRATION_INTENSITY))
.isEqualTo(Vibrator.VIBRATION_INTENSITY_OFF);
}
private void updateSetting(String key, int value) {
Settings.System.putInt(mContext.getContentResolver(), key, value);
}
private int readSetting(String settingKey) throws Settings.SettingNotFoundException {
return Settings.System.getInt(mContext.getContentResolver(), settingKey);
}
}
